Winner 8, a little Dutch kid with a trunk!

Launched at the end of 2014, the Winner 8 was presented for the first time in France at the Grand Pavois. The opportunity for us to introduce you to the smallest of this Dutch range.

The Winner 8 is available in 2 versions. The Comfort version ( white hull on the pictures ), intended for cruising has a shallower draft and moderate sail area. On the other hand, the performance version ( red hull ) with a horned mainsail and a draught increased to 1.50 m is there to make the gunpowder talk.

If the fittings are more consequent in the performance version, the bowsprit is present on both versions. This appendage retracts, but does not appear in the forward cabin. It is located under the deck and does not pose a risk of water infiltration as is often the case with retractable booms.

Nothing to say about the cockpit and deck plan, very classic, but also very efficient with a tiller that acts on the 2 rudders.

It's when you get inside the boat that the surprise is created: the volume of the Winner 8 impresses. This sailboat of only 8 meters looks a lot more than that. It's actually an extrapolation of Winner 9. The shipyard wanted to keep the same sizes of front and rear cabins.

Thus the Winner 8 lost 50 cm at the stern and 50 cm at the galley level in the saloon. But the rest of it looks like a Winner 9. This is why, still with the aim of freeing up space in the aft cabin, the yacht is equipped with 2 rudders on the transom, no suspended rudders.

The quality of construction for which the yard is renowned is found on board this model, the smallest in the range. Inside, the forward cabin is presented as a Breton bed open to the saloon. The aft section is reserved for a beautiful double cabin and a toilet on the starboard side. The "shortened" saloon allows only one single berth on the port side.

Designed by Van de Stadt, this Winner 8 is easy to handle and will allow you to cruise in complete peace of mind, whatever the conditions encountered.

CHARACTERISTICS :

Winner 8
Length HT 8,00 m
Length at waterline 7,30 m
Width 2,85 m
draft Comfort version 1,00 m
Performance version draft 1,50m
Comfort/Perfomance version move 2,4/2,3 t
Comfort/Perfomance version 1/0,9 t
Surfing GV Comfort/Perfomance version 23/26 m2
Genoa surface Comfort/Perfomance version 17/18 m2
Spinnaker surface Comfort/Performance version 52/56 m2
Awards 62,397 euros excluding VAT
